LG63 YMF is a 2013 Kia Sportage in Silver with a 1,995c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90.9%.
Across all 2013 Kia Sportage models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.4% with a typical mileage of 64,196 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Kia Sportage fails its MOT is br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ick, accounting for 16,003 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LG63 YMF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Kia Sportage typ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 13 years old, this Kia Sportage is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
